**Document Transport: Calibration Weight Batches**

Calibration weights from Merrow Metrology ship in foam-lined cases, one batch per run. Coordinator assigns a single driver; no mixed loads. Cases stay upright, never stacked. Delivery log signed at both ends. At the destination, the driver completes the hand-over per the confidential instruction below.

handover note for yagef-bagep: the drudor pelius courier leaves the kasdor zorvan norir ledger at gate 8016 under passcode 755406

## Break-Glass: InkForge Render Pipeline

Plugin authors: if the InkForge sandbox rejects your renderer signature and support is unreachable, use break-glass. This bypasses signature checks for 30 minutes and logs everything to the audit stream. Do not ship plugins while it is active. Run `inkforge unlock --emergency` from a trusted host. The command prompts for the recovery passphrase shown below.

recovery phrase for bawef-kagug: casix-tamvan-lamath-holeth-gilmir-drudor-julax-wenok-wenael-rusvan-holax-goriel-frawyn

The Fanwright fan-out service sheds load by signing and publishing backpressure policy bundles that edge relays verify before applying. If relays receive an unsigned or stale bundle, they fall back to the last known-good policy, which can mask a real incident. On-call: always confirm the bundle signature timestamp before assuming throttles took effect. Rotation happens quarterly; mismatches page the Dunmore Hollow pager rotation. Verification requires the current signing key, reproduced here for convenience.

deploy key for fawip-tafop: bky3_Ldi

For the reviewer: while we migrate the legacy Gristmill ORM layer to the new repository pattern at Fennelworth Systems, the migration user occasionally trips the lockout threshold because old connection pools retry with stale credentials. When that happens, schema diffs in your review environment will fail silently. Recovery is straightforward: stop the pool, clear the cached credentials, and reauthenticate the migration account through the Fennelworth identity console using the recovery passphrase given directly below.

unlock words, yagag-yahog: gordor-zorvan-druius-queniel-normir-norwyn-framir-novmir-ralius-holwyn-wenwyn-tamael-silok-holdor